Notes | IMPORTANT: 1-Wire Electrically Programmable Read Only Memory (EPROM).If using the PR-35 package on the DIP socket module attachthe Ground pin to pin 1 the Data pin to pin 2 and the NC pin to pin 3 ofthe DIP socket module.The following describes the memory map:Address range [0000h-1FFFh] is the Data Memory (EPROM);Address range [2000h-201Fh] contains Write Protect Page bits of the data memory;Address range [2020h-203Fh] contains Write Protect bits of the Page Address Redirection Bytes;Address range [2040h-205Fh] is the Bit Map of Used Pages;Address range [2060h-20FFh] is reserved for future extensions (should be set to 00h);Address range [2100h-21FFh] contains the Redirection Bytes;Address range [2200h-2207h] contains the 64-Bit Lasered ROM (read only).Please refer to the user specification for more information. |
